How to Assess Prey Drive in a Dog

Prey drive is one of the key components of your dog's hereditary makeup. It's hard wired into him. Training a dog like this means knowing how to bring out the prey drive. Interestingly enough, many of the traits dogs are bred for such as hunting or herding are the ones that get them into trouble today during training, as they chase anything that moves. This isn't always appreciated by the owner.

Instructions

    • 1

      Determine if your dog chases everything that moves, loves to retrieve, digs and follows the scent trail of other animals. Prey drive is brought out in your dog by using motion.

    • 2

      Implement the use of hand signals, but not the stay signal, to get the prey drive to kick in. Be aware that dogs high in prey drive are easily distracted.

    • 3

      Excitedly speak in a high-pitched tone of voice to capture the dog's interest and get him revved up to work without over doing it. Signals and tone of voice mean more to dogs with high prey drive than commands. So long as the dog finds what he is doing interesting, he will cooperate.

    • 4

      Engage your dog's attention with an object he finds attractive such as a stick, ball, Frisbee or food. Those dogs with a predominant prey drive are easily motivated, but at times hard to control.

    • 5

      Chase your dog and see if he loves chasing in return. If your dog gets wildly excited, he is in prey drive and will concentrate on what interests him. Patience is required to teach this dog. While you may think he has a short attention span, he doesn't.
